Open Access iconOpen Access

ARTICLE

ESSD: Energy Saving and Securing Data Algorithm for WSNs Security

by Manar M. Aldaseen1, Khaled M. Matrouk1, Laiali H. Almazaydeh2,*, Khaled M. Elleithy3

1 Computer Engineering Department, Al-Hussein Bin Talal University, Ma’an, Jordan
2 Software Engineering Department, Al-Hussein Bin Talal University, Ma’an, Jordan
3 Computer Science and Engineering Department, University of Bridgeport, CT, Bridgeport, USA

* Corresponding Author: Laiali H. Almazaydeh. Email: email

Computers, Materials & Continua 2022, 73(2), 3969-3981. https://doi.org/10.32604/cmc.2022.028520

Abstract

The Wireless Sensor Networks (WSNs) are characterized by their widespread deployment due to low cost, but the WSNs are vulnerable to various types of attacks. To defend against the attacks, an effective security solution is required. However, the limits of these networks’ battery-based energy to the sensor are the most critical impediments to selecting cryptographic techniques. Consequently, finding a suitable algorithm that achieves the least energy consumption in data encryption and decryption and providing a highly protected system for data remains the fundamental problem. In this research, the main objective is to obtain data security during transmission by proposing a robust and low-power encryption algorithm, in addition, to examining security algorithms such as ECC and MD5 based on previous studies. In this research, the Energy Saving and Securing Data algorithm (ESSD) algorithm is introduced, which provides the Message Digest 5 (MD5) computation simplicity by modifying the Elliptic Curve Cryptography (ECC) under the primary condition of power consumption. These three algorithms, ECC, MD5, and ESSD, are applied to Low Energy Adaptive Clustering Hierarchy (LEACH) and Threshold-sensitive Energy Efficient Sensor Network Protocol (TEEN) hierarchical routing algorithms which are considered the most widely used in WSNs. The results of security methods under the LEACH protocol show that all nodes are dead at 456, 496, and 496, respectively, to ECC, MD5, and ESSD. The results of security methods under the TEEN protocol show that the test ends at 3743, 4815, and 4889, respectively, to ECC, MD5, and ESSD. Based on these results, the ESSD outperforms better in terms of increased security and less power consumption. In addition, it is advantageous when applied to TEEN protocol.

Keywords


Cite This Article

APA Style
Aldaseen, M.M., Matrouk, K.M., Almazaydeh, L.H., Elleithy, K.M. (2022). ESSD: energy saving and securing data algorithm for wsns security. Computers, Materials & Continua, 73(2), 3969-3981. https://doi.org/10.32604/cmc.2022.028520
Vancouver Style
Aldaseen MM, Matrouk KM, Almazaydeh LH, Elleithy KM. ESSD: energy saving and securing data algorithm for wsns security. Comput Mater Contin. 2022;73(2):3969-3981 https://doi.org/10.32604/cmc.2022.028520
IEEE Style
M. M. Aldaseen, K. M. Matrouk, L. H. Almazaydeh, and K. M. Elleithy, “ESSD: Energy Saving and Securing Data Algorithm for WSNs Security,” Comput. Mater. Contin., vol. 73, no. 2, pp. 3969-3981, 2022. https://doi.org/10.32604/cmc.2022.028520



cc Copyright © 2022 The Author(s). Published by Tech Science Press.
This work is licensed under a Creative Commons Attribution 4.0 International License , which permits unrestricted use, distribution, and reproduction in any medium, provided the original work is properly cited.
  • 1257

    View

  • 730

    Download

  • 0

    Like

Share Link